Home
last modified time | relevance | path

Searched refs:extraInstructionVisitor (Results 1 – 10 of 10) sorted by relevance

/external/proguard/src/proguard/optimize/peephole/
DNopRemover.java40 private final InstructionVisitor extraInstructionVisitor; field in NopRemover
62 InstructionVisitor extraInstructionVisitor) in NopRemover() argument
65 this.extraInstructionVisitor = extraInstructionVisitor; in NopRemover()
83 if (extraInstructionVisitor != null) in visitSimpleInstruction()
85extraInstructionVisitor.visitSimpleInstruction(clazz, method, codeAttribute, offset, simpleInstruc… in visitSimpleInstruction()
DGotoGotoReplacer.java41 private final InstructionVisitor extraInstructionVisitor; field in GotoGotoReplacer
63 InstructionVisitor extraInstructionVisitor) in GotoGotoReplacer() argument
66 this.extraInstructionVisitor = extraInstructionVisitor; in GotoGotoReplacer()
107 if (extraInstructionVisitor != null) in visitBranchInstruction()
109extraInstructionVisitor.visitBranchInstruction(clazz, method, codeAttribute, offset, branchInstruc… in visitBranchInstruction()
DGotoReturnReplacer.java41 private final InstructionVisitor extraInstructionVisitor; field in GotoReturnReplacer
63 InstructionVisitor extraInstructionVisitor) in GotoReturnReplacer() argument
66 this.extraInstructionVisitor = extraInstructionVisitor; in GotoReturnReplacer()
105 if (extraInstructionVisitor != null) in visitBranchInstruction()
107extraInstructionVisitor.visitBranchInstruction(clazz, method, codeAttribute, offset, branchInstruc… in visitBranchInstruction()
DUnreachableCodeRemover.java48 private final InstructionVisitor extraInstructionVisitor; field in UnreachableCodeRemover
68 public UnreachableCodeRemover(InstructionVisitor extraInstructionVisitor) in UnreachableCodeRemover() argument
70 this.extraInstructionVisitor = extraInstructionVisitor; in UnreachableCodeRemover()
137 if (extraInstructionVisitor != null) in visitAnyInstruction()
139 instruction.accept(clazz, method, codeAttribute, offset, extraInstructionVisitor); in visitAnyInstruction()
DInstructionSequencesReplacer.java89 InstructionVisitor extraInstructionVisitor) in InstructionSequencesReplacer() argument
95 extraInstructionVisitor)); in InstructionSequencesReplacer()
119 … InstructionVisitor extraInstructionVisitor) in createInstructionSequenceReplacers() argument
133 extraInstructionVisitor); in createInstructionSequenceReplacers()
DGotoCommonCodeReplacer.java50 private final InstructionVisitor extraInstructionVisitor; field in GotoCommonCodeReplacer
61 public GotoCommonCodeReplacer(InstructionVisitor extraInstructionVisitor) in GotoCommonCodeReplacer() argument
63 this.extraInstructionVisitor = extraInstructionVisitor; in GotoCommonCodeReplacer()
142 if (extraInstructionVisitor != null) in visitBranchInstruction()
144extraInstructionVisitor.visitBranchInstruction(clazz, method, codeAttribute, offset, branchInstruc… in visitBranchInstruction()
DInstructionSequenceReplacer.java90 private final InstructionVisitor extraInstructionVisitor; field in InstructionSequenceReplacer
139 InstructionVisitor extraInstructionVisitor) in InstructionSequenceReplacer() argument
146 this.extraInstructionVisitor = extraInstructionVisitor; in InstructionSequenceReplacer()
201 if (extraInstructionVisitor != null) in visitAnyInstruction()
207 extraInstructionVisitor); in visitAnyInstruction()
/external/proguard/src/proguard/optimize/evaluation/
DSimpleEnumUseSimplifier.java57 private final InstructionVisitor extraInstructionVisitor; field in SimpleEnumUseSimplifier
89 InstructionVisitor extraInstructionVisitor) in SimpleEnumUseSimplifier() argument
92 this.extraInstructionVisitor = extraInstructionVisitor; in SimpleEnumUseSimplifier()
615 if (extraInstructionVisitor != null) in replaceInstructions()
619 instruction.accept(clazz, null, null, offset, extraInstructionVisitor); in replaceInstructions()
645 if (extraInstructionVisitor != null) in replaceInstruction()
649 instruction.accept(clazz, null, null, offset, extraInstructionVisitor); in replaceInstruction()
674 if (extraInstructionVisitor != null) in deleteInstruction()
678 instruction.accept(clazz, null, null, offset, extraInstructionVisitor); in deleteInstruction()
DEvaluationSimplifier.java57 private final InstructionVisitor extraInstructionVisitor; field in EvaluationSimplifier
82 InstructionVisitor extraInstructionVisitor) in EvaluationSimplifier() argument
85 this.extraInstructionVisitor = extraInstructionVisitor; in EvaluationSimplifier()
1223 if (extraInstructionVisitor != null) in replaceByInfiniteLoop()
1231 extraInstructionVisitor); in replaceByInfiniteLoop()
1256 if (extraInstructionVisitor != null) in replaceInstruction()
1260 instruction.accept(clazz, null, null, offset, extraInstructionVisitor); in replaceInstruction()
1349 if (extraInstructionVisitor != null) in replaceSimpleEnumSwitchInstruction()
1357 extraInstructionVisitor); in replaceSimpleEnumSwitchInstruction()
/external/proguard/lib/
Dproguard.jarMETA-INF/ META-INF/MANIFEST.MF proguard/ proguard/FileWordReader.class FileWordReader ...